
VC编程实现BS模式远程控制简易教程

标题中提到的“VC实现BS结构编程”,这里指的是使用Visual C++(VC)这一开发工具来实现基于浏览器(Browser)和服务器(Server)结构(BS结构)的编程。BS结构是当今网络应用的主要架构模式,它通常指的是客户端使用Web浏览器作为界面,通过HTTP/HTTPS协议与服务器端进行数据交互的一种网络应用部署方式。在这种架构中,用户界面是通过浏览器来显示,服务器端则处理业务逻辑、数据存储等操作。
描述中所提到的代码来源《黑客编程》,表明了这份代码不仅是用来学习BS结构编程的优秀范例,也可能涉及到了一些网络编程的高级技巧和概念。通常,黑客编程往往利用了底层网络协议的特性,因此参考此类代码可以更好地理解网络通信的过程以及如何在程序中实现特定的功能。
关于知识点的详细说明,以下是根据标题、描述和标签所推断的要点:
1. BS架构基础:BS架构是软件开发中的一种客户端/服务器模式,用户通过浏览器作为客户端访问网页,服务器响应请求并提供服务。BS架构的开发涉及前端(客户端)和后端(服务器端)的开发。前端主要使用HTML、CSS和JavaScript等技术,后端则可能使用各种服务器端语言如PHP、Java、Python或VC等。
2. VC开发环境:Visual C++(VC)是微软公司的一个集成开发环境(IDE),主要用于C++语言的开发。VC支持多种开发,包括Windows应用程序、动态链接库(DLL)以及MFC(Microsoft Foundation Class)应用程序等。
3. BS结构编程的实现:在BS结构中,VC通常用于开发服务器端的组件,例如动态生成网页内容的服务器应用程序,或提供业务逻辑处理的接口。实现BS结构编程需要熟悉网络通信协议,例如TCP/IP,以及HTTP/HTTPS协议。开发者还需要掌握Web服务器和数据库服务器的操作和配置。
4. 网络编程知识:《黑客编程》中的代码很可能涉及到了网络编程的基础概念,例如套接字(Socket)编程,网络通信中的连接、请求和响应处理,以及数据封装与解析等。在VC中,可以使用Winsock API来创建网络应用程序。
5. 代码实践的重要性:描述中强调了代码学习的重要性,这意味着实际操作和实践是掌握BS结构编程的关键。通过分析和理解实际的代码例子,可以更好地理解理论知识,学习如何将网络通信、服务器处理和客户端界面连接在一起。
6. 远程控制技术:在文件名称列表中提到的“BS模式远程控制简单实现”,这可能指的是一种远程控制方案的实现,其中BS模式意味着远程控制的操作是通过浏览器来完成的。这可能涉及到Web界面设计、远程执行命令、文件传输等技术点。
从描述和标签来看,这些知识点对于希望深入了解和掌握BS结构编程,尤其是希望在VC环境下开发网络应用的开发者来说,都是极为重要的。通过学习相关的概念、技术和实际案例,可以有效地提升个人在BS架构编程方面的能力。
相关推荐








qjcnzxlws
- 粉丝: 0
资源目录
共 6 条
- 1
最新资源
- IrisSkin2.0:强大易用的界面美化控件介绍与使用指南
- 《数学模型(第三版)》习题详解
- Apache Ant 1.7.1 版本在 Linux 平台的应用与特性
- Win32汇编实现窗口菜单及背景变换示例
- 老外牛逼A*寻路算法详细解析与实现
- 汇编语言自学课件:英文版详解及2009课程资料
- MFC对话框中自绘彩色按钮的实现方法
- 深入理解PCI规范中文版及BIOS编程指南
- ICP算法实现三维点云配准的C++代码分析
- uCOS-II 2.85版本操作系统源码发布
- 全面掌握GNU make工具与Makefile编写技巧
- 哈尔滨工业大学数字电路课件分享与复习指南
- 全面解读ERP应用与计算机课件教程
- VF学生信息管理系统开发实践
- EVEREST硬件检测工具深入解析
- DAEMON Tools 4.10版软件使用教程与下载
- Java Web快速开始Hibernate与SQLite整合实践指南
- 微软与Google面试题深度解析与解答
- C#全面学习资料包:从基础到高级技术指南
- 中小型企业的客户管理利器:南江电话监控软件
- Linux系统面试题及参考答案精讲
- 锁相环技术文章全集下载
- C语言简易计算器与动态小人源码分享
- 深入浅出:自定义Ajax与JavaScript闭包模式